Tanmiah Food Posts SAR 1.1M Net Loss in Q1 2026

Tanmiah Food Company (2281) announced its Q1 2026 financial results, posting a net loss of SAR 1.1 million versus a net profit of SAR 18.9 million in the same period last year. Revenue increased 8% to SAR 731.2 million, driven by higher fresh poultry volumes and restaurant operations.

Tanmiah Food Company (2281) announced its interim financial results for the three months ended March 31, 2026, reporting a net loss of SAR 1.1 million, compared to a net profit of SAR 18.9 million in the year-ago period. Revenue rose 7.989% year-on-year to SAR 731.2 million, driven by an 8.6% increase in fresh poultry volumes to 43.2 million birds and a 42.2% surge in restaurant operations revenue.

Key Financial Results

ItemQ1 2026Q1 2025Change
RevenueSAR 731.2MSAR 677.1M+8%
Net Profit (Loss)(SAR 1.1M)SAR 18.9M-106%
EPS (SAR)(0.06)0.95-106%

Highlights from the Statement

  • Fresh Poultry revenue reached SAR 551.9 million, with average daily production of 604,000 birds.
  • Restaurant Operations saw a 42.2% revenue increase due to successful marketing campaigns.
  • Net loss attributed to higher diesel and utility costs, increased distribution expenses, elevated financing costs, and ramp-up costs for new assets.
  • Agribusiness segment generated a net profit of SAR 10.8 million, offset by an SAR 11.9 million net loss in Restaurant Operations.
  • Shareholders' equity decreased 12.355% YoY to SAR 614.3 million.

Guidance

The company did not provide specific forward guidance.
